My favorite yoga studio in the area! Most classes are heated 85-90 degrees and there is a parking lot in the front, which gets filled up so come early. The studio offers blocks and restraining bands for use during the class. Towels can be rented, water bottles can be bought. I've enjoyed all types of classes here, highly recommend.
